Comments: Loop was generally dry, with the exception of a few mud puts in the usual places east of the summit. Trail is not formally signed or marked and is a little tricky to follow in a few places due to logging in recent years. The clockwise loop starts at the far end of the first logging cut, with some blue tape marking the entrance to the woods.

Trout lily just starting to bloom.
